> You know, from what little I've worked with it, I think I do like
> Gnome.  At least I like Ubuntu's rendition of Gnome.  Besides, this is
> the first Linux LiveCD that actually works on a my Mac.  It doesn't
> work perfectly, but that's OK for now.
> 
> What works:
>   - I get a functioning Gnome desktop
>   - networking (wired)
>   - X11
>   - audio
>   - mouse (touchpad)
>   - keyboard
>   - FireFox
>   - GAIM
> 
> What doesn't work:
>   - no Thunderbird (what's up with that?)
>   - wireless (sees the device but doesn't load the right drivers)
>   - booting into a different runlevel
>   - changing to virtual terminals (maybe the key combination is
> different than I expect)
>   - Evolution (crashes Ubuntu when authenticating to Exchange)
>   - volume keys on keyboard
>   - it sort-of mounts the Apple harddrive (it can mount /dev/hda10, but
> only 4 files show.  Where's the rest?)
